Abstract

Background: Helicobacter pylori related gastritis is a significant wellbeing infirmity in developingnations. There is high bleakness and mortality extending from ceaseless gastritis to gastricmalignancies. Commonness of H. pylori contamination changes notably from nation to nation andin a nation, locale to area. Point: To contemplate the pervasiveness of H. pylori gastritis in patientsundergoing endoscopy and its relationship with the advancement of gastrointestinal illnesses .
Subjects and Strategies: The examination was done in Al hussein educating hospitalfrom September 2018 to Walk 2019 . 40 Patients giving dyspeptic manifestations were exposed to upper gastrointestinal endoscopy , examined for H. pylori contamination through h.pylori immune response IGg test ,and histopathological assessment done forantral biopsy. Information examination was completed utilizing SPSS
Results: H. pylori disease was analyzed in 57.5%of patients screened. There was no statisticallysignificant contrast in sex and age related circulation of H. pylori disease. Be that as it may, a measurably critical relationship of H. pylori disease with sydney reviewing of gastritis .Conclusion:H.pylori contamination connection factually not critical with segment normal for the patient and endoscopic discovering. However, it's critical corresponding to gastritis as indicated by sydney evaluating where p value<0.005 and < 0.001in connection with presence of intense and interminable changes.
